N2 - Sports and athletes’ highest performance offer a fascinating scenario to investigate perceptual-motor expertise. The remarkable work of Joan Vickers has captured this opportunity and built a valuable experimental paradigm. Our commentary emphasizes what information is being acquired during the period of Quiet Eye (QE), capable to produce successful performance. First, an extended notion of visual system that includes posture is presented. It is suggested that QE would represent a collective postural effort (resulting from movements of eyes, head, trunk, and whole body) to acquire the relevant information available in the optic flow. Second, the contribution of neural structures and functioning for vision and attention is discussed. Models of neural networks of attention and two visual systems are described with respect to QE and some questions about action parameters and motor programs are raised.
